Rapid Rail Suspends LRT Operations At Six Stations, Starting April 2

Jesica Sendai

Share via



Rapid KL recently announced that six stations on the Ampang – Sri Petaling LRT line will be suspended starting this Sunday onwards (April 2, 2023).

According to the train service operator, the procedures require six Light Rail Transit (LRT) stations on the Ampang-Sri Petaling line which involves the Bandaraya, Sultan Ismail, Putra World Trade Centre (PWTC), Titiwangsa, Sentul and Sentul Timur stations to be halted.

This issue also derives from a damaged track that happened between Masjid Jamek and Bandaraya stations which was reported earlier in January. From there, it affects the connection to other stops on this LRT line.




It further added that said suspension was due to the trains used for services between Bandaraya and Sentul Timur stations no longer meet the operational criteria and deemed to be taken out of service for safety reasons.

"This is following the structural and runway damage near the Bandaraya LRT station, which has resulted in trains not being able to return to the Ampang LRT Depot to undergo maintenance works since Jan 27,'' RapidKL said in a statement.

Thus, Rapid KL agrees to provide five train stations that will be operating between Bandaraya – Sentul Timur stations after the division from the rest of the Ampang – Sri Petaling LRT line.




To smooth the journey of affected users, Rapid Rail offers free LRT 13 and LRT 14 Express Bus services starting Sunday in addition to the existing LRT 11 bus service.

A total of 40 bus units will be provided with an operating frequency of between 10 to 15 minutes during peak hours depending on the current traffic conditions.

Meanwhile, do take note that the LRT 9 (Hang Tuah LRT – City LRT) and LRT 10 (Masjid Jamek LRT – City LRT) bus services will be terminated from Sunday (April 2, 2023).

As another alternative of transportation, those who plan to go to Hang Tuah may take the Monorail from Titiwangsa, while those heading to Chan Sow Lin may use the Putraya MRT line also through Titiwangsa.
